Tasha Ghouri: From Strictly to It Takes Two:

Reality TV & New Roles: Tasha Ghouri Returns and BBC Confirms The Celebrity Traitors UK begins with Tasha Ghouri’s comeback. She made history as the first deaf contestant on Strictly Come Dancing. Her use of a cochlear implant inspired fans, and her presence reshaped British culture on TV.

Now, Tasha moves into a presenter role on It Takes Two. This shift feels powerful because she knows exactly what the contestants face. For US readers, think of Dancing With the Stars and then imagine a former competitor becoming the show’s behind-the-scenes host. It’s emotional, authentic, and adds depth to reality TV shows.


The Celebrity Traitors UK: A BBC Masterstroke:

The BBC confirmed The Celebrity Traitors UK, and it’s already drawing huge buzz. The format blends strategy and suspense as stars compete while hidden traitors plot against them. Confirmed names include Tom Daley, Stephen Fry, and Jonathan Ross.

For Americans familiar with The Traitors US, this version feels like a British twist with big personalities. The mix of fame and betrayal ensures drama. It also shows how celebrity culture adapts to new challenges, keeping reality TV fresh and addictive.
